Administrative / biographical background

The Medicines Commission was established in 1969, under the terms of the Medicines Index Act 1968. Its duty is to advise a body of ministers of the Department of Health and Ministery of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food on matters relating to the execution of the act and, in particular, on the licensing and certification of medicinal products.

The act requires that the commission has at least eight members. Members are appointed by the body of ministers, after consultation, and includes members with no scientific background as well as people with wide and recent experience in the fields of medicine (including veterinary medicine), pharmaceutics, and chemistry.
